They work together so well, basically. captain Commando isn't great on point, but his anti air assist is VERY useful for the other two characters, so by putting him last, you essentially give yourself a good chance of never having to pull the man out. That's just an example.
I'm not to knowledgeable on MvC2, but generally speaking, the tiers of the game are based more on overall teams, then on individual characters.

Cable: Three AHVBs (air hyper viper beam specials) in a row basically kills. He grounds people with his jumping fierce punch and his grenades.
Storm: EXTREMELY fast, great combos, runaway, hail storm.
Magneto: Cross-up/infinite king.
Sentinel: Just too good.
